> I have to comment on these statistics. Well I am Lebanese and I passed on
> 9th of Oct where Lebanon had 17 CCIE. They updated the statistics on
> 10/10/2008 and it shows that Lebanon still has 17. So this does not really
> reflect the true numbers my profile shows am in the states because i am
> currently here for interchip with cisco so that they can ship the
> certificate to my place. I know many different nationalities with this
> status. So its not pretty accurate.
